“Had a fab time”

★★★★☆

written by Jaxt296 on 27/04/2014

Just returned from a 4 night break at Haggerston Castle. Myself and son and a great time. The site offered all that we needed. We were very pleased to be upgraded on our arrival. The caravan was very clean and warm (however lacked instructions to work central heating). The staff were excellent, and very helpful. Assistant leisure manager gave some very good service. My son aged 8 enjoyed the high ropes and aqua jets, and found them good value for money. We also had a massage in the spa, and Gemma gave me some pain but was very good. My son had his first massage too, and loved it, some very lovely people in the spa. The mash served some good food and drink, however the heating needed to be turned up, we were freezing, wear a jumper. The evening entertainment is not something that I enjoy, but many others did. The site has a 9 hole golf course which could do with some money and tlc spent on it, however could not fault the staff. Haggerston castle is on the A1 and you really need a car to get anywhere. Places I recommend: Holy island, Alnwick gardens and Castle a must. We did go to the Tree top restaurant, and was a magical experience, however very disappointed with the food. A vey enjoyable holiday, thankyou Haven

“Not good at all!”

★★☆☆☆

written by johnsod2 on 01/09/2013

Although caravan was clean and in quiet location it was quite a walk to the centre. There was no brush or pan to sweep the floor from grass carried in after lawns had been mowed. The quilt on the double bed was too small so when one person turned over the other froze to death! Not sorted by staff despite complaints. Passes and prices for "extra" events very expensive as was the food. The best bits of the site were the horse riding and "creative design" people - neither of whom are connected to Haven. Booked sessions for shooting and archery for three people at a cost of £8 per session only to be told that because I had bought an alcoholic drink and taken a couple of sips I couldn't do either. The events guide needs to ensure it stipulates that people will not be able to take part if they have had a drink. Some staff were very sulky and not at all friendly. Entertainment was poor with visibility in the main lounge from the two balcony layers almost impossible. The Cinderella panto was ridiculous with no possibility of interaction from the kids as it was almost all sung! The duet between Buttons and Cinders was basically a sales pitch to buy a caravan!!! Despite having been to haggerston 25 and 10 years ago we will NOT be going again. Best bits were all off park!!

“Haven Haggerston Castle.......Never again!!”

★☆☆☆☆

written by on 23/10/2012

After touring Scotland for a week in our motorhome we booked two nights at Haggerston Castle touring park as a stopover before returning home. As the weather had not been good we did expect the ground to be very wet but thought as this was a well known large site there shouldn't be too much to worry about. However, when arriving at our pitch we found the area to be ankle deep in mud. The hard standing was only just wide enough to fit the vehicle so you had to step into the mud to get in and out. I asked the staff for assistance and was told to look for a pallet around the site!! My husband hunted around and found one to place at the door. It would help if there had been gravel around the pitch. When leaving the motorhome later we noticed dog mess around the area (next to children's play area). The toilets/showers were just about usable but not at all clean by any standards.The handbasins were full of dirty water.(Must have been blocked but didn't put my hand in to check!!) Three toilets had broken locks. The whole block looked liked it hadn't been cleaned all day when I went to them at 5pm. Luckily we had onboard facilities so at least we had a choice whether to use them or not.On the first night we went to the restaurant in the entertainment complex and were so disappointed with the quality of the food we asked to make a complaint to a manager. We were told managers do not speak with customers and to fill in a feedback form which we did.We didn't go back the second night and decided to buy fish and chips from the onsite vendor. This was very nice even though a bit overpriced. Altogether we had a very disappointing experience at Haggerston Castle. This could be a beautiful site if a little more effort was made by the management. After all, it is an All Year Round site and Scotland is renowned for wet weather.

“Not Happy”

★★★☆☆

written by on 04/09/2011

Having a dog means we can only ever have standard or standard plus caravan which has resulted in us getting very poor, dirty, scruffy caravans therefore we decided to book privately without going through Haven. Our Caravan last year was lovely & had all the gadgets,m dvd, iron etc however the caravan we booked this year was dirty, no iron or ironing board, the oven went off on the second night there & the gas had to be turned off to the oven & grill so we had only a hob for the rest of a weeks stay! The outside light didn't work, the decking & veranda were unsafe & the caravan had a foisty, nasty smell....there were several more problems which have all gone in an email to the owner. Although this is actually not Haven renting it I still think they should have been more helpful considering they charge the owners for keeping the caravan on the site...they told us they only hold the keys & could do nothing to assist us without speaking to the owners. This ment several phone calls by us to the owner to complain about the various problems. I would say though that the Funpasses are very over priced & unfairly priced.....£39.50 Adult £22.25 Child (under 13 being a child) therefore it cost £140.75 for my family of 2 Adults a 15 yr old & an 11 yr old !!! As we have a dog we do not like to leave him too often so in a 7 night stay we may go out 2 nights in total, we don't use the swimming pool & because we trake the dog most places we do not go into the complex for the children to do the activities...so basically for 2 nights out (spending money on overpriced drinks)& to be allowed in to spend money in the arcade it cost us over £140 !!!!! Not good value at all & I think they should do a daily pass or something to accomadated people who may not want to be in the complex all day every day!!! This is a Haven thing & I think it should be adressed. I would not recommend any Haven park as value for money, it can be as or more expensive than a sunshine holiday abroad...
